Adelaide Crapsey

Verse is a collection of experimental poetry by Adelaide Crapsey, published posthumously in 1922. Notably, Crapsey is credited with creating the cinquain, a five-line poetic form that emphasizes brevity and precision. This collection showcases her innovative approach to verse and her unique voice in early 20th-century American poetry.
